Colac Otway residents, businesses and community stakeholders are invited to provide feedback on Council’s Draft Economic Development Framework, now on public exhibition.

The Draft Framework has been developed as a long-term direction to guide how Council will support local jobs, business growth and investment across the Shire.

Council Chief Executive Officer Andrew Tenni said the draft was developed in response to local feedback about what is needed to support sustainable economic growth.

“Council heard clearly from our community and business sector that economic development needs to be focused, realistic and aligned with the strengths of our region,” Mr Tenni said.

“This Draft Framework reflects the feedback we got and is intended to provide direction for Council to prioritise and support industry and position Colac Otway for future investment.”

More than 120 local businesses and stakeholders contributed to the development of the Draft Framework, identifying key priorities such as workforce, housing, infrastructure, planning and investment.

The Draft Framework has shifted from outlining a fixed list of actions to setting the direction and priorities of Council to guide future planning, investment and delivery, allowing Council to respond to changing conditions and maintain consistent focus.

Mr Tenni said the next stage of community feedback would be critical in ensuring the Draft Framework reflects local priorities and is practical for Council to deliver.

“Council is now asking the community to review the Draft Framework and tell us if we have the direction right and let us know if there is anything that we may have missed,” Mr Tenni said.

Following the exhibition period, Council will review all submissions and consider a final version of the Economic Development Framework.
